Biography
I was born and raised in Lima, Peru. I am the oldest of three of an intact family. After finishing Catholic School education, completed 8 years of Medical School at Cayetano Heredia Peruvian University. Came to the US to do my residency training in Psychiatry at Maimonides Medical Center, Brooklyn, NY where I was appointed Chief Resident. After that, I relocated to Arkansas for three years to complete my 3-year J-1 visa waiver. It was a great experience since I was the only psychiatrist in 3 counties of rural Arkansas. Before to move to Miami, I worked for 3 years in Jacksonville, FL where I was adjunct Assistant Professor of University of Florida College of Medicine-Jacksonville. I have been a faculty for the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ences for 6 years and it has been the greatest academic and research-oriented experience. I am currently married and I have 2 wonderful daughters.
